How to install Nginx using YUM under CentOS7 system

WBOY
Release: 2023-05-21 08:40:06
forward
1502 people have browsed it

简介

nginx 是由 igor sysoev 为俄罗斯访问量第二的 rambler.ru 站点开发的,第一个公开版本0.1.0发布于2004年10月4日。其将源代码以类bsd许可证的形式发布,因它的稳定性、丰富的功能集、示例配置文件和低系统资源的消耗而闻名。

centos 7 条件

教程中的步骤需要root用户权限。

一、添加nginx到yum源

添加centos 7 nginx yum资源库,打开终端,使用以下命令:

sudo rpm -uvh http://nginx.org/packages/centos/7/noarch/rpms/nginx-release-centos-7-0.el7.ngx.noarch.rpm
Copy after login

二、安装nginx

在你的centos 7 服务器中使用yum命令从nginx源服务器中获取来安装nginx:

sudo yum install -y nginx
Copy after login

nginx将完成安装在你的centos 7 服务器中。

三、启动nginx

刚安装的nginx不会自行启动。运行nginx:

sudo systemctl start nginx.service
Copy after login

如果一切进展顺利的话,现在你可以通过你的域名或ip来访问你的web页面来预览一下nginx的默认页面;

How to install Nginx using YUM under CentOS7 system

如果看到这个页面,那么说明你的centos 7 中 web服务器已经正确安装。

centos 7 开机启动nginx

sudo systemctl enable nginx.service
Copy after login

nginx配置信息

网站文件存放默认目录

/usr/share/nginx/html
Copy after login


网站默认站点配置

/etc/nginx/conf.d/default.conf
Copy after login

自定义nginx站点配置文件存放目录

/etc/nginx/conf.d/
Copy after login

nginx全局配置

/etc/nginx/nginx.conf
Copy after login

在这里你可以改变设置用户运行nginx守护程序进程一样,和工作进程的数量得到了nginx正在运行,等等。

linux查看公网ip

您可以运行以下命令来显示你的服务器的公共ip地址:

ip addr show eth0 | grep inet | awk '{ print $2; }' | sed 's/\/.*$//'
Copy after login

The above is the detailed content of How to install Nginx using YUM under CentOS7 system. For more information, please follow other related articles on the PHP Chinese website!

Related labels:
source:yisu.com
Statement of this Website
The content of this article is voluntarily contributed by netizens, and the copyright belongs to the original author. This site does not assume corresponding legal responsibility. If you find any content suspected of plagiarism or infringement, please contact admin@php.cn
Popular Tutorials
More>
Latest Downloads
More>
Web Effects
Website Source Code
Website Materials
Front End Template